How can I clearly define the project goals when hiring an Adobe Illustrator expert?

Start by describing what you want to create. Think about the style and details that are important for your project. Be clear and simple, like saying 'I want a bright logo with blue and green colors.' This makes sure the freelancer knows exactly what you picture in your mind.

What should I include in the job description to attract the right Adobe Illustrator expert?

Your job description should describe the project well. Mention the type of graphics you need, like logos or illustrations. Include any specific skills, such as working with layers or using certain tools in Illustrator. This helps experts know if they can do the job.

How can I communicate deliverables clearly to a freelance Adobe Illustrator artist?

List out all the things you want the artist to make. Be clear if you need editable file types like AI files or just final versions in JPG or PNG. Mention any deadlines or dates you need things by, so your freelancer can plan their work.

What should I look for in a freelance Adobe Illustrator portfolio?

Check if their work looks similar to the style you want. Look for examples of things like logos or infographics. Their work should look professional and clean. This shows they know how to use Illustrator well.

How do I ensure the freelancer understands my brand guidelines?

Share any brand guidelines or style guides with the freelancer. Tell them what colors, fonts, and styles to use or avoid. This way, they can make sure their work matches your brand's look and feel.

What is a good way to set a timeline for my project with a freelancer?

Divide your project into smaller steps. Decide when each step should be done. Talk with the freelancer about how long each part might take. Make sure everyone agrees on the timeline so that the project runs on time.

How can I collect feedback during the project from an Adobe Illustrator expert?

Set up times to check in and see their progress. Ask for drafts or rough versions of the work. Share your thoughts early on so they can make changes if needed. This helps both of you stay on track and make sure the final work is perfect.

What should I consider when agreeing on the final deliverables with the expert?

Be sure about the formats and versions you need. Ask for any extra files if needed, like vector files. Make sure you and the freelancer are on the same page. This ensures the final product meets your needs and can be used as you plan.

How many revisions should I allow during the Adobe Illustrator project?

Think about how many times you may need changes to get the work just right. Agree on this number with the freelancer at the start. It helps you both understand how the project will go. This way, everyone knows what to expect.
